Our verdict on Foxglove
Foxglove is a small operator that does not restrict winning accounts and pays free bets as cash with no wagering attached. Withdrawals are the slowest we timed and the market list is thin. Across forty markets a month it averages 5.2%, thirteenth of fifteen, and our six test withdrawals cleared in 12 — 48 hrs. Its strongest categories are support and promotions; the weakest is markets, at 6.5.

How the prices measure up
We price the same forty markets every month across all fifteen bookmakers. The margin is the built-in edge — lower is better for you.
Across all forty markets Foxglove averages 5.2% — thirteenth of fifteen, roughly 1.8 points behind Kestrel. On a £50 stake that difference is around 90p a bet, which is the single strongest argument for opening an account elsewhere.
